SEW Experts: It Pays to Link Consistently

Search Engine Watch Expert - Mark JacksonYou have control over the internal links on your site, so be sure you're taking advantage of that when creating them. In today's Organic Search Engine Optimization column, "It Pays to Link Consistently," Mark Jackson takes a look at ways to improve your Web site's consistency in internal linking and the use of your domain name, which can make a big difference in your site's organic search engine rankings.
